High-viscosity methylphenyl silicone fluid offering excellent thermal stability across a wide temperature range (–50 °C to +200 °C).
Low volatility and minimal evaporation loss, ensuring long-term performance in sealed and high-temperature systems.
Outstanding dielectric properties with high volume resistivity and low dissipation factor, suitable for electrical insulation applications.
Chemically inert toward most metals, plastics, and elastomers, minimizing compatibility concerns in multi-material assemblies.
Hydrophobic and oxidation-resistant, providing reliable lubrication and protection in humid or aggressive environmental conditions.
Dielectric fluid in high-voltage transformers, capacitors, and electronic potting compounds.
Lubricant for precision instruments, optical mechanisms, and vacuum system components.
Base fluid in specialty greases for aerospace, automotive, and industrial bearings requiring extreme-temperature stability.
Thermal transfer medium in heating/cooling baths and semiconductor process equipment.
Formulation component in release agents and surface treatment fluids for high-performance coatings and composites.
| Chemical Type | Methylphenyl polysiloxane |
| Product Form | Clear, colorless liquid |
| Appearance | Clear, water-white, odorless |
| Kinematic Viscosity @ 25 °C | Approx. 1000 cSt (ASTM D445) |
| Density @ 25 °C | Approx. 0.97 g/cm³ (ASTM D1475) |
| Flash Point (COC) | ≥ 300 °C (ASTM D92) |
| Volume Resistivity @ 25 °C | >1 × 10¹⁴ Ω·cm (ASTM D257) |
| Upper Operating Temperature | +200 °C (continuous) |
